Međuselje
Međuselje is a village in the municipality of Višegrad, Bosnia and Herzegovina.| Tap on a place to explore it |

The Mehmed Paša Sokolović Bridge is a historic bridge in Višegrad, over the Drina River in eastern Bosnia and Herzegovina part of the Republika Srpska entity.
